People ask me why of all the places I choose Seremban. For the simple reason that hotels in Seremban is much cheaper than hotels in Bukit Bintang and food in seremban are much cheaper too. Moreover I was on my way to A Famosa Resort in Alor Gajah hence that is the most convenient place to stay. Moreover I can easily go to Port dickson which I have never been to before.

Hotel that we stayed - Carlton Star Hotel( @RM 75 per night per room) - cheap ,big room, clean, got wifi ( but signal very weak since we were staying on the third floor) and the hotel is within walking distance to the main bus terminal.

While in Seremban, we went to the famous Min Kok for Dimsum. how to fo th Min Kok take the free shuttle bus from Terminal 1 to Terminal 2. Min Kok is just walking distance from Terminal 2


This was what we ordered:



Comment: moderate price but tea is very cheap - one pot of pu er RM 2 only. Outside look deserted but once you went into the restaurant ,lot of people inside.

Port Dickson
Very easy to go from Seremban . Just take the free shuttle bus from Terminal 1 to Terminal 2 and every hourly there is bus going to Port Dickson. Personally port Dickson is not that great. Nothing interesting or unique there... beaches, resorts, stalls selling souvenirs

We asked around for the famous Seremban siew pow and the locals recommended this shop.We bought quite a few of different flavour siew pow to bring to a Famosa Resort.

Comment; Seremban siew pow are crispier than Kuching siew pau. Taste wise, Kuching siew paus taste better.
